With all due respect...
Reader comment on item: The Liberty Incident: The 1967 Israeli Attack on the U.S. Spy Ship

Submitted by Adam J. Bernay (United States), May 1, 2005 at 02:57

With all due respect to Master Chief White and all the other survivors of the LIBERTY -- and I do respect and honor them for their proud service -- but how can they know it was intentional? They were the ones being attacked, but they had no direct access to the plans, the thoughts, etc., and it is doubtful they heard the inter-fighter radio traffic... and even if they did, did the radio operator understand Hebrew? They cannot know whether or not the attack was deliberate. It is wrong to castigate them as anti-Semites. I cannot see that their positions are racially motivated. They are more likely motivated over the natural tendency to want their pain and suffering to have a tangible cause they can fight against. If they admitted it might've been a mistake, then they might see their wounds and their sacrifices as being in vain; not that they should, as they were incurred in proud and noble service to this country, no matter the reasons for the assault.

As for whether or not the attack was deliberate, there is evidence on both sides. In fact, the evidence I've seen leads me to believe that: 1) Israel was guilty of gross negiligence in target identification, which is tragic and stupid but understandable in the fog of war, 2) the LIBERTY wasn't where it was supposed to be by JCS orders, but possibly didn't receive the orders, and 3) there is no reason to point fingers over this. However, we just don't know. A new investigation, open and honest, with independent and unbiased investigators from both countries, should probably occur, just to lay the matter to rest.

People naturally want to assign blame. It's a natural tendency of a human being. I think we need to look past all that.
